Muscogee School District, Public Education Center
The Muscogee School District Public Education Center is a 96,000 SF, three-story administrative building in Midtown Columbus, Georgia. The building was designed to consolidate multiple district departments in one centralized location to improve collaboration, operational efficiency, and public access to district services.
Designed to complement the surrounding civic environment, the education center features a neoclassical architectural style with cast stone masonry as the primary exterior material. Its scale and detailing reinforce the character of Midtown Columbus while visually aligning with the nearby Columbus Public Library, helping strengthen the area’s civic identity.
Interior design services supported the district’s transition into the new facility. The process began with a comprehensive survey and documentation of existing furniture, accessories, and artwork across multiple district offices. Department leaders were interviewed to identify functional needs and workplace preferences, helping shape the selection of furnishings and interior elements for the new building.
